The Case for Hiring Based on Skills, Not Diplomas
The traditional job description has long featured a standard line: “bachelor’s degree required.” But that requirement is increasingly under scrutiny. According to an HRDive article from February of 2024, firms such as IBM, Accenture, Google and Delta Air Lines have dropped bachelor’s degree requirements for many middle-skill and some higher-skill roles since the COVID-19 pandemic. What’s driving this shift?
- Labor market tightening: Employers can’t afford to overlook candidates who have real-world experience but lack formal education.
- Job relevance: Many roles, especially in logistics, manufacturing, healthcare support, and customer service, depend more on hands-on know-how than on a four-year degree.
- Diversity and inclusion: Degree for the nearly two-thirds of the US workforce that lacks a degree — a percentage that is higher among Black, Latino and indigenous workers.
- Technology and training: The rise of micro-credentials, certifications, and on-the-job learning has expanded how candidates gain relevant skills.

How Employers Benefit from Skills-Based Staffing
Embracing skills-first hiring is good for candidates and is also a strategic advantage for businesses. Here’s why:
- Wider Talent Pool: Removing unnecessary degree requirements opens up access to experienced professionals who may have been overlooked.
- Faster Time-to-Hire: Candidates with relevant experience can onboard quickly, cutting down on costly vacancy time.
- Higher Retention: Employees placed based on actual role-fit tend to perform better and stay longer.
- Improved DEI Outcomes: Skills-based hiring can support more inclusive hiring practices.
- Cost Efficiency: You can save on salary premiums often associated with degree-holding candidates without sacrificing performance.
